| Fitness Programs for Older Adults – A Training Workshop, Day 2: Selected Chronic Conditions in the Elderly | ||
| Structure | Council on Aging and Adult Development | |
| Description | This pre-convention workshop is an innovative, “hands-on” session providing exciting interventions/solutions for practitioners working with older adults. AAALF/CAAD in partnership with Flaghouse, offers practitioners a workshop to support their requirements for continuing education. National experts provide practitioners with the latest information regarding chronic conditions and “best practice” techniques for exercise. Agenda: (1) Introduction to cardiovascular/pulmonary conditions/diseases and exercise (2) Enhancing cardiovascular function through rhythmic activities; (3) Administrative concerns for cardiovascular/pulmonary exercise programs; (4) Understanding the effects of activity on arthritis, joint replacement, and lower back pain; (5) Core strength development; (6) Aquatic exercise for cardiovascular/pulmonary enhancement; (7) Relaxation techniques.
